Block 3901389

7d57616aaea673368f034150f83921d66a10e894c5251e83bd078bd6c08f805e
Transactions1
Height3901389
Confirmations1542948
TimestampSun, 31 Oct 2021 06:05:25 UTC
Size (bytes)187
Version536870912
Merkle Rooteedc333d3512f1b693901afda285b37e3ab9b956a6c4ad0163636c7bd09e47bc
Nonce3430226616
Bits1c078e8b
Difficulty33.87621834129912

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
1542947 Confirmations20 FTC